This puzzle features at 4 down my first ever Spoonerism clue . It’s a rare device in cryptics but far from unknown. Alan Connor in his crossword blog on the Guardian website does a quite thorough analysis here.
Because the only possible Spoonerism indicator is a reference to Spooner, it is a distinctly unsubtle device and thus unsatisfactory if used often.
Fresh Spoonerisms are also quite hard to devise although the original Dr Spooner’s students and colleagues at Oxford wrung a good lot out of the joke even as the poor man continued to work and attempted to retain the respect and serious attention of his students.
The story is told in the Guardian’s obituary from 1930. It seems that Dr Spooner never really told a student that he had “tasted a whole worm.” Nor did he really tell a groom that it is “kistomary to cuss the bride.”
Hard to devise as they may be, a friend of mine has developed quite a knack for Spoonerisms and has come up with some beauts. My favourite: Horace Rabbit for Robert Harris, the café and coffee brand.
